抄録

In this study, an axial force sensor was developed and evaluated for a screw bolt using optical fiber grating (FBG: fiber Bragg grating). This sensor has high tolerance to electromagnetic noise. Furthermore, it has a characteristic long-distance signal transmission ability because it was made using optical fiber. This washer type sensor forms a circular projection because the stress distribution in the sensor is obtained only proportional to the axial force of the screw bolt. The axial force sensor was experimentally developed for an M10 screw bolt. According to test results, the reflection wavelength shift was proportional to the axial force, implying that this sensor has excellent characteristics.
